Real Time Operating Systems (RTOS) Market size was valued at US$ 2,186.7 in 2030 projected to reach US$ 3,223.4 million by 2030 and is poised to grow at 5.7% CAGR from 2024-2030. RTOS are specialized operating systems designed to process data and respond to inputs within strict time constraints, making them crucial for applications where timing is critical. RTOS is widely used in embedded systems, IoT devices, and industrial control systems, offering deterministic behavior and reliable performance. The increasing adoption of IoT devices and the growing demand for connected and autonomous vehicles are key factors driving the expansion of the RTOS market. For example, the number of IoT-connected devices worldwide is expected to reach 30.9 billion by 2025, up from 13.8 billion in 2021, according to IoT Analytics.
RTOS facilitates real-time data processing and decision-making in these devices, enhancing their performance and reliability. Moreover, the rising implementation of Industry 4.0 technologies in manufacturing sectors is boosting the demand for RTOS in industrial automation applications. For instance, the global Industry 4.0 market size is projected to reach US$ 165.5 billion by 2026, growing at a CAGR of 20.6% from 2021 to 2026. However, the complexity of developing and implementing RTOS solutions, especially for resource-constrained devices, poses challenges to market growth. Additionally, the increasing need for cybersecurity measures in RTOS to protect against potential vulnerabilities in connected systems is a growing concern for developers and end-users alike.

The market is experiencing growth driven by the increasing complexity of embedded systems and the need for deterministic performance in critical applications. The automotive industry, in particular, is a significant driver of RTOS adoption, with the rise of advanced driver-assistance systems (ADAS) and autonomous vehicles requiring robust real-time processing capabilities. The healthcare sector is another key growth area for RTOS, with medical devices and patient monitoring systems requiring reliable and real-time performance. The global medical devices market, valued at $495.46 billion in 2022, is projected to reach $718.92 billion by 2029, with RTOS playing a crucial role in ensuring the safety and efficacy of these devices. However, the market faces challenges from the increasing complexity of multi-core processors and the need for RTOS solutions that can effectively manage parallel processing while maintaining real-time performance.

The key players in the market include Wind River Systems, BlackBerry QNX, Green Hills Software, Mentor Graphics (Siemens), ENEA AB, Micrium (Silicon Labs), Express Logic (Microsoft), FreeRTOS, Lynx Software Technologies, and SYSGO AG.
The key drivers for the market include the increasing adoption of IoT devices, growing demand for connected and autonomous vehicles, rising implementation of Industry 4.0 technologies, and the need for deterministic performance in critical applications across various industries.
The key factors hampering the growth of the global RTOS market include the complexity of developing and implementing RTOS solutions for resource-constrained devices, challenges in managing multi-core processors while maintaining real-time performance, and increasing cybersecurity concerns in connected systems.
